What is the full form of Kotak Mahindra Bank?

What is the full form of Kotak Mahindra Bank?

In February 2003, Kotak Mahindra Finance Ltd. (KMFL), the Group's flagship company, received banking license from the Reserve Bank of India (RBI), becoming the first non-banking finance company in India to convert into a bank - Kotak Mahindra Bank Ltd.

Why is Kotak called Mahindra?

The company obtained the certificate of commencement of business on 11th February 1986 and the Existing promoters were joined by Mr Harish Mahindra and Mr Anand Mahindra. The company's name was changed on 8th April 1986 to its present name Kotak Mahindra Finance Ltd.

What is 811 means in Kotak?

Kotak 811 brings you a Virtual Debit Card inside your Mobile Banking App. You can use it to shop online, pay bills, recharge or use 'Scan & Pay' at merchant outlets. 811 Debit Card is given to customers who have verified their details using Aadhaar OTP.

When was Kotak 811 launched?

About Kotak811 When 8th November, 2016 changed the way India transacted forever, Kotak811 was launched to simplify banking and make it fully accessible online.31-Mar-2022
